Output 03e30f0b245a4af32ce4ccb90d9fc89a75063cb0c5cdf7cb56aaeb4e3cbc4add:2

value
58893350
script pubkey
OP_0 OP_PUSHBYTES_20 a76f8c33dbb286c5e9ea51714b129323b5184b6f
address
bc1q5ahccv7mk2rvt60229c5ky5nyw63sjm0tav865
transaction
03e30f0b245a4af32ce4ccb90d9fc89a75063cb0c5cdf7cb56aaeb4e3cbc4add
confirmations
131071
spent
true